ABOUT THE CONCERT
From the hot jazz of George Gershwin interpreted by the Marcus Roberts Trio, to a world premiere by Fresno's own Jack Fortner, Maestro Kuchar's season opening program invites everyone to celebrate the musical richness and diversity of American music.
Since bursting upon the jazz scene as the pianist for the Wynton Marsalis Septet, Marcus Roberts has become one of the leading jazz artists of our time. Hear for yourself why critics call his Trio's performances with orchestra of Gershwin's Rhapsody in Blue "unforgettable," "spectacular," and "dazzling."
